Abstract

Insects have important role in forensic science for solving problems related to murder and mysteries. Forensic Entomology is the use of the insects and other arthropods that feed on decaying remains to aid legal investigations. Therefore in the present paper history of Forensic Entomology, why insects are used in Forensic Science, major groups of insects associated with cadavers, insect life cycle and medico legal aspects, role of autopsy surgeon and challenges in Forensic Entomology were discussed.
